1998 World Junior Championships in Athletics – Men's long jump

Medalists

GoldPetar Dachev
 Bulgaria
SilverAbdul Rahman Al-Nubi
 Qatar
BronzeLuis Felipe Méliz
 Cuba

Participation

According to an unofficial count, 34 athletes from 22 countries participated in the event.
